Bengals Cornerback Competition Intensifies with Multiple Players Competing for Starting Roles

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

The Cincinnati Bengals are experiencing a competitive training camp, particularly at the cornerback position, where several players are vying for first-team spots. Coach Zac Taylor has emphasized the fluidity of the lineup during these early weeks, with Cam Taylor-Britt, Dax Hill, and DJ Turner being the primary starters last season. Taylor-Britt is being cautiously managed, Hill is recovering from a torn ACL, and Turner is looking to improve after a challenging 2024 season. Newcomers like Josh Newton and DJ Ivey are making strong cases for starting positions, with Newton showcasing his tackling and coverage skills, and Ivey demonstrating his ability to stop tight ends effectively. The competition is fierce, with players like Turner showing significant improvement in recent practices.
